Linux On Blackberry Passport !!exclusive!! · Original

Linux On Blackberry Passport !!exclusive!! · Original

The result is a surprisingly capable environment where you can perform real development tasks. Through Term49, you can install and run a wide range of command-line tools and programming languages:

: Unlocking the bootloader typically requires physically replacing the EMMC flash chip and reflashing boot partitions, a process involving delicate soldering.

Common issues and solutions:

The BlackBerry Passport, with its distinctive design and feature set, has attracted a dedicated following among enthusiasts and developers. While the device was originally designed to run BlackBerry OS 10, the open-source nature of Linux and the availability of community-driven projects have made it possible to run Linux on this device. This paper aims to provide a comprehensive guide for those interested in exploring Linux on the BlackBerry Passport.

But in 2024, the Passport faces an existential crisis: BlackBerry 10 OS is effectively dead. The infrastructure is crumbling, the browser is outdated, and the Android runtime (which once saved the app ecosystem) is an ancient relic stuck on Jellybean. linux on blackberry passport

Setting up the environment teaches a massive amount about containerization, network loops, Android runtimes, and POSIX architecture. The Future: Will We Ever See Native Boot?

The ability to run shell scripts, SSH, and coding tools. 1. Native Linux (PostmarketOS / Mainline Linux) The result is a surprisingly capable environment where

However, open-source developers routinely surprise the tech world. Projects like (which aims to extend the life of old smartphones past ten years) continuously update kernels for older Snapdragon processors. If an exploit is ever found that completely bypasses or replaces the BlackBerry bootrom, the Passport could theoretically see a flawless, native port of a mobile Linux OS.

The BlackBerry Passport uses a UEFI (Unified Extensible Firmware Interface) boot loader, which is responsible for loading the operating system. The UEFI firmware is stored in a dedicated partition on the device's internal storage. While the device was originally designed to run

Using bridged network drivers, you can give this Linux container its own access to the internet via the Passport’s Wi-Fi. B. Project Berry & APK Methods